San Antonio's extremely hard Edwards Aquifer water (18-25 GPG) is the dominant factor in drain issues — mineral scale builds up relentlessly inside pipes, narrowing flow capacity and creating blockage points. The city's affordable cost of living makes drain cleaning one of the more budget-friendly services among major metro areas. A basic drain cleaning runs $100-225, with hydro jetting for heavy scale removal reaching $600.
Drain Cleaning Cost Breakdown in San Antonio
| Service / Type | Price Range | Notes |
|---|---|---|
| Basic snaking (sink/tub) | $100 – $180 | Simple clogs near the fixture |
| Toilet unclog | $110 – $200 | May need to pull the toilet |
| Main line snaking | $160 – $340 | Cleanout to city connection |
| Hydro jetting | $275 – $600 | Best for San Antonio's mineral scale |
| Camera inspection | $100 – $240 | Bundled with main line service |
| Floor drain cleaning | $100 – $215 | Common in San Antonio garages |
Factors That Affect Drain Cleaning Cost in San Antonio
- Extremely hard water: San Antonio's Edwards Aquifer water (18-25 GPG) is among the hardest in the nation. Without a water softener, mineral scale builds rapidly and is the primary cause of drain issues.
- Limestone-rich sediment: The aquifer's limestone geology means calcium carbite deposits are especially dense and difficult to remove with a standard cable snake.
- Affordable labor: San Antonio's cost of living keeps plumber rates ($65-100/hour) among the lowest of major metros, making drain cleaning quite affordable.
- Tree root intrusion: Live oaks and other mature trees in older San Antonio neighborhoods can infiltrate sewer laterals, though this is less common than scale-related issues.
- Military housing: San Antonio's large military community creates steady demand, and many plumbers offer military discounts.
- Emergency surcharges: After-hours and weekend calls add $50-100 to base prices. Schedule during business hours when possible.
What to Expect During Drain Cleaning
A standard drain cleaning in San Antonio takes 30-90 minutes. Your plumber will assess the problem, then select the right tool. For the heavy mineral scale typical in San Antonio pipes, hydro jetting is often recommended over simple snaking for main line work. Cable snaking will punch through the blockage, but scale remains and flow restricts again quickly. Main cleanouts in San Antonio homes are typically in the front yard. Camera inspections are valuable for seeing how much scale has accumulated.
How to Save Money on Drain Cleaning in San Antonio
- Get at least 3 quotes — San Antonio's plumbing market is very affordable
- Install a water softener — this is the best long-term investment for protecting your drains in San Antonio's hard water
- Use drain screens in all sinks and showers
- Never pour cooking grease down the drain — Tex-Mex and barbecue grease combined with mineral scale creates especially tough blockages
- Military families: ask about military discounts, many San Antonio plumbers offer them
- Try enzyme-based drain treatments monthly to break down organic matter before it combines with mineral deposits
When to Call a Pro
Call a plumber when a plunger won't clear the clog, when multiple drains slow down together, when drains make gurgling sounds, or when you detect sewage odors. In San Antonio, gradually slowing drains are the telltale sign of mineral scale buildup — address this before it becomes a complete blockage. Also call if you notice water backing up into floor drains during heavy use.
